f6c71b9897
Fix progress tracking of schedule, render participant users and feedback link using the newly created components
316e75c3f7
Implement the old template rendering of the event component
89d6ad71d9
Add language and event type classes to event cells
2afc4f2b6a
Create speaker and feedback link components
1dd3ff9292
Add ids and relations to the API responses, add completion flag to data loading hook
4774dcda11
Fix propTypes
86833b5276
Fix schedule chooser
24bcaa6d23
Sample event rendering
78064e3f8f
Move schedule components to a separate directory
ad782899b2
Switch to light theme
ae89ee0356
Fix Twitter and GitHub icons in speaker profiles
11607b67f9
Add fontawesome
e7f25a860d
Fix speakers rendering
6fb3d5f8ba
Fix member pictures rendering
923daf9005
Move inline CSS to the stylesheet
d1788e9e97
Fix schedule rendering
b53de67c6f
Fix rendering of schedule tracks, use CSS classes from the old template
27f248ef7d
Add most of the schedule CSS from the old template
b5e2e292d8
Add language flags
157d3df733
Add SASS embedded
8a429b0a93
WIP Rework conference loading, temporary remove the language and year chooser
3eaf86ba2d
Do not show hidden tracks in the track list
e5108ff5d9
Show progress bar on the same row with year selection
0cd5365c93
Fix CFP URL so CORS is allowed
b46549485c
Add hall labels to schedule
77c88b2075
Render all requests data
c6e1ed6ef1
Add hooks for all requests
ff715b610b
Conference selection
cba2439f11
Add prop-types
1b14b697c9
Add schedule loader
e87e4b9502
Remove CSS
51a938f5b2
Add SWR
86e6c879f5
Remove default stuff, add semicolons
be8def6333
Create new Vite+React project